最赞回答 / 人间世支离疏
简单讲解一下3和2层,然后自己验证4层的移动,验证move(4,a,b,c)的第一步骤move(3,a,c,b)下面的7个步骤就可以。2层:move (2,a,b,c) #都会先判断是否为1 #然后不是,就会进行接下来三步: 1:move(n-1, a, c, b),2: print a, '-->', c,3:move(n-1, b, a, c) 1:move(1,a,c,b)#分析此处的内部运作 #因为是1,所以不走三步,直接执行if下print a-c,但是这里可能就导...
2019-03-13
已采纳回答 / 慕函数1500656
Python好像没有运算符&,与运算and,或运算or,另外如果是求100以内奇数和,按你的逻辑用与运算只会进入一次while就会结束循环,但如果用或运算则变成了求100以内的数的和
2019-03-12
已采纳回答 / 朦胧5
你是在网页上测试,还是用自己的软件测试?网页上测试的话,把代码照搬上去就可以了;如果是软件上的话,输出语句需要加上括号 print()还要注意区分中英符号、字符大小写,python可是严格区分的
2019-03-12
最新回答 / zctmdc
cd后面的\ 是根目录的意思 \LearnPython是磁盘根目录下面的LearnPython文件夹在你这个情况下 是c:\LearnPython 如果没有这个文件夹就找不到如果是当前目录下的LearnPython 请去掉\
2019-03-12
已采纳回答 / zctmdc
字典里面 key就是目录 value就是内容 我们查字典都是要根据目录找到对应的内容,也就是根据key查询value所以根据分数查找名字时,分数是key,而名字是value。
2019-03-12
最赞回答 / weixin_慕虎5413914
本来看不懂代码里的abc是怎么换来换去的,参考了大神的文章,很容易理解,共享给大家http://fourcolor.oursnail.cn/2019/02/26/algorithms-basic/%E5%9F%BA%E7%A1%80%E7%AE%97%E6%B3%952-%E6%B1%89%E8%AF%BA%E5%A1%94%E9%97%AE%E9%A2%98/
2019-03-12
已采纳回答 / Awful_Leo
True和False是布尔值,就像1,2,3是整数,“abc”是字符串一样。做这个题,需要了解以下两点:第一,在一个语句中,当and和or同时存在时,and的优先级高于or。第二,所谓“短路原则”,即对于...
2019-03-12